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: Correction to group reconciliation

...

By assigning and revoking partitions for the members of the group, the group coordinator can balance the partitions across the members of the group.

The member provides the rebalance timeout to the group coordinator when it joins the group. This is the timeout for the group coordinator waiting for the member to acknowledge that it has adopted the target assignment. If the member does not confirm the target assignment within the rebalance timeout, the group coordinator removes the member from the group.

Member ID

Every member is uniquely identified by the UUID called the member ID. This UUID is generated by the group coordinator and given to the member when it joins the group. It is used in all communication with the group coordinator and must be kept during the entire lifespan of the member.

...